Contact your local branch for the most accurate information & requirements.Interest rates for SBA loans in Lawrence, can vary widely based on the lender, loan type, and your personal credit profile. Traditional banks typically offer rates between 6% to 12% for well-qualified borrowers, though approval can be strict. SBA loans in Lawrence, which are popular for new businesses, generally have rates ranging from 6% to 13%, depending on the loan program. Alternative and online lenders may have higher rates, often between 6% to 30%, as they take on more risk, offer more flexible requirements, and time to funding is much faster.

In Marion County's Lawrence township, local business owners can access SBA loan programs through various qualifying sectors. Small enterprises like professional services, retail shops, construction companies, and service-related businesses often meet federal lending requirements for financial support.
Qualifying businesses typically include restaurants, medical practices, automotive repair shops, home improvement contractors, and technology startups located within the Indianapolis metropolitan area. The Small Business Administration evaluates each applicant's creditworthiness, business plan, and economic potential before approving funding.
